Enhancing Clinical Skills Through Simulation Labs
Simulation labs play a pivotal role in enhancing clinical skills within blended learning nursing programs. These virtual environments offer a safe and controlled space for nurses-in-training to practice complex procedures, manage emergency situations, and interact with patients without real-world risks. By immersing themselves in realistic scenarios, students can improve their decision-making abilities, refine technical skills, and gain confidence before applying them in actual healthcare settings.
In the context of accelerated nursing programs or accredited nursing degrees, simulation labs complement traditional classroom learning and clinical rotations. They facilitate a deeper understanding of evidence-based nursing practices by allowing students to experience diverse patient cases and apply current medical knowledge. This hands-on approach promotes critical thinking, fosters collaboration among peers, and prepares future nurses for the dynamic nature of healthcare environments.
